Sixteen year old Mirma Ffaraz (Mateen) is a 1st year intermediate student. He comes from a middle class family. His father Mir Mazher Ali works as a salesman and is the sole bread winner in this big family of six children (Mateen and his 5 sisters). His mother is a house wife.
Mateen works part-time in an optical store and earns Rs. 2,000 ($45) per month to support his family. He works from 10am to 12pm and after which he attends regular college for his studies.
He joined HOPE computer training center to learn computers. After college, in the evening he learns computers to add a value to his regular course. He hopes to get employed in a good firm and support his family.
Your sponsorship of Mateen’s computer training course has come as a boon to this family as it not only helps him learn computer application but also enables him to meet the needs of his family.
By standing on his own feet, Mateen can ensure that his siblings get better education.
